[QUOTE="DoCoMo, post: 2970526, member: 59413"] The Sat Nav system in your 350z is a complicated monster. It offers connectivity to many of your other electronics such as the reverse camera and bose sound system. Therefore you cannot remove/update the exisiting Sat Nav system because it will render all your other electronics unusable but you can rewire/install a new sat nav system over-riding the current one and display maps via your in-dash screen. Having said that, Garmin offers a very reliable system that can be installed into your 350z seamlessly without affecting any of your other electronics. Put simply, with a bit of re-wiring and $$$ you will have a no fuss GPS system taking the place of your current Jap sat nav without you even noticing it. [/QUOTE]
